Marine Thunderstorm Wind — Gulf of Mexico Including Dry Tortugas and Rebecca Shoal Channel, Gulf of Mexico

2017-05-24 · near Dry Tortugas Light, Gulf of Mexico Including Dry Tortugas and Rebecca Shoal Channel, Gulf of Mexico

37 MG
Magnitude

Event narrative

A wind gust of 37 knots was measured at Pulaski Shoal Light.

Wider weather episode

A strong low pressure system over the Ohio Valley and strong trailing cold front extending into the central Gulf of Mexico and associated pre-frontal trough approached the Florida Keys. Strong thunderstorms along the pre-frontal trough and moving rapidly northeast off Cuba's north coast produce widespread gale-force wind gusts throughout the Florida Keys coastal waters.
